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Общий по Linux (http://forum.oszone.net/forumdisplay.php?f=9)
-   -   [решено] .htaccess в корне (http://forum.oszone.net/showthread.php?t=177769)

Endy1 09-06-2010 18:14 1430869

.htaccess в корне
 
Друзья, помогите написать правильный .htaccess

Есть корень виртуального сервера Apache /srv/domen1

В этой папке, а также в каждом ее подкаталоге находится каталог .svn/ с управляющими файлами. Примерно так:

/srv/domen1/.svn/
/srv/domen1/first/.svn/
/srv/domen1 /second/.svn/
.....

Положить в каждую .svn/ папку свой .htaccess проблематично, т.к. таких каталогов сотни. Возможно ли сделать единственный .htaccess в корне /srv/domen1, который бы запрещал доступ к файлам во всех папках .svn/ независимо от уровня их вложенности?

Признателен за любой совет.

Endy1 10-06-2010 17:23 1431633

Никаких идей нет? Может быть я не совсем ясно поставил вопрос?

Sham 11-06-2010 01:16 1431875

в конфиге сервера что-то типа этого
Код:

<DirectoryMatch "\.svn">
  Deny from all
</DirectoryMatch>


Endy1 11-06-2010 11:44 1432059

Спасибо.
Нашёл альтернативное и более красивое решение:

Options +FollowSymLinks
RewriteEngine on

RewriteRule \.svn/ - [F]


Время: 21:58.

Время: 21:58.
© OSzone.net 2001-